
Shiremoor Health Centre and Service Centre
The Health Centre and Pharmacy opened to the public on 13 June 2005.
The Service Centre opened to the public on 8 October 2007.
The Shiremoor Health Centre is a new facility housing existing services from the former Shiremoor Health Centre. The range of health services provided from the centre includes:
General Practice
- Space for ten GPs, currently configured as one practice for four GPs and two practices for three GPs
PCT Community Services
- Anticoagulation (blood clinic)
- Chiropody
- Child and Adolescent Mental Health Service (CAMHS)
- District nursing
- Bed-wetting (enuretic clinic)
- Health visitors
- Adult mental health services
- Community midwives
- Nutrition and dietetic services
- Orthoptist
- Community psychology
- Community psychiatric nursing (CPN)
- Audiology hearing, screening and assessment
- Physiotherapy
- Speech and language therapy
- Welfare food sales
- School health advisor
- Nurse practitioners
- Community disability service
- Community development workers
- Family planning services
Local Authority Services
The Service Centre provides a customer service facility and library for North Tyneside Council and is linked to the Health Centre. Next door is a Sure Start centre and a council centre providing access to various council run and voluntary services.
Pharmacy
A pharmacy and shop operated by the Seaton Valley Co-Operative Society
